Abstract

A photographic medium comprising a binder free layer of silver halide microcrystals 0.1-0.5 microns thick supported on a substrate and a photo-sensitizing material disposed on the substrate supporting the silver halide layer and on the open surface of the silver halide layer is formed by the vapour deposition of the silver halide layer. The sensitizer which may be a chemical or optical sensitizer is selected from the group of solid non halogen elements of the Periodic Table in Groups 1 through V1 and V111 and organic compounds such as cyanine dyes, condensation products of alkylene oxides, polyamines, polyvinyl resins, sulfoxide and complexed borane hydrides. Inorganic compounds such as copper halides, ammonium halides and acetate and salts providing hydroxyl ions in solution may also be used. The substrate may be glass, paper, gelatine, resins such as polyethylene terephthalate, polyvinyl chloride, copolymers of vinyl acetatevinyl chlorides, polystyrene, polyamides, cellulose acetate and cellulose propionate. The sensitizer is preferably deposited on the substrate by vapour deposition although it may also be formed from solution. After the formation of the silver halide layer an outer layer of another sensitizer is formed on the halide layer either by vapour deposition or from solution. The following specific examples are described:- 1) substrate of subbed polyethylene terephthalate is coated with gold by vapour deposition then with vapour deposited silver bromide and then with an outer sensitizer layer of vapour deposited gold. 2) As example 1 with an outer sensitizer layer of vapour deposited 1,1' diethyl 2,2' - carbocyanine bromide (pinacyanol).
